Preserving and Presenting Sculpture at Olympic Sculpture Park: How SAM Conservation cares for our outdoor sculpture collectionsErin Fitterer | Assistant Objects Conservator, Olympic Sculpture Park
The Olympic Sculpture Park features 22 monumental sculptures by modern artists including Tony Smith, Mark di Suvero, and Louise Bourgeois. Outdoor sculptures require constant maintenance to look their best and endure for future generations. The ever-changing northwest environment makes caring for these works challenging and rewarding. Erin Fitterer, the newest member of SAM’s conservation team, will share insights on treatments conservators perform to preserve these complex sculptures and ensure they remain vibrant and accessible in the museum’s outdoor collection.
